What are Advanced Energy Management Systems (EMS)?
Advanced Energy Management Systems (EMS) are technologies designed to monitor, analyze, and optimize solar performance in real time. Key Functions: Risk Detection: Identifies issues like overheating, voltage irregularities, and grid imbalances before they escalate.
What is a residential EMS system?
A residential EMS ensures that the energy generated during the day is stored and used in the evening, reducing dependence on the grid and lowering your energy bills. Additionally, such a system can help you live more sustainably by maximizing the use of renewable energy.
What is the difference between BMS EMS & PCs?
In modern energy storage systems, BMS, EMS, and PCS form an inseparable trinity. The BMS safeguards the health and safety of batteries. The EMS optimizes energy usage through smart scheduling and system control. The PCS executes the physical charging and discharging operations.
